I was jamming and messing around and came up with this riff inspired by the classic blues tune “Rollin’ and Tumblin’”, and figured I’d share
That song’s been recorded by 100s of blues artists, and apparently dates back to 1928, but the versions I always think about are the ones by Muddy Waters, Cream and Johnny Winter.
